Output 0fb31bc08ea4fa711507ad1b0e4e203cc67b43506bb052d2181b8d0e3beb6816:3

value
8336238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4c41f0b57933306fa97c5a796deadab324f6ef8 OP_EQUAL
address
3JApVpP8fjpgTGRgANjFnrFg7SysiDLtwU
transaction
0fb31bc08ea4fa711507ad1b0e4e203cc67b43506bb052d2181b8d0e3beb6816
confirmations
266538
spent
true